Conoce algunos de los gestores de bases de datos más usados.

Un gestor de base de datos es conocido como un conjunto de programas que sirven de interfaz entre el usuario y la base de datos para tener una sencilla manipulación de los datos.

Un SGBD debe permitir especificar tipos y estructuras, permite la manipulación de los datos mediante consultas y la actualización de la base de datos de manera sencilla, existen diferentes gestores de bases de datos, aquí te mostrare los mas usados.

MySQL

Es uno de los gestores de bases de datos más usados tanto por la comunidad estudiantil como por las empresas, está desarrollada bajo las licencias de GPL y la licencia comercial de Oracle.

Nació en el año de 1995, de la mano de Michael Widenius y David Axmark, surgió de la necesidad de un buen sistema de almacenamiento, fue así como salió MySQL y junto con ello MySQL AB. Este gestor de base de datos es el más popular de código abierto y es utilizada por Twitter, Facebook y YouTube gracias a su rendimiento y confiabilidad.

ORACLE

Es conocido como uno de los gestores de BD más completos gracias a su estabilidad y su soporte multiplataforma, el costo de este depende del tipo de licencia que se adquiera y se puede usar en distintos sistemas operativos, una de las desventajas a parte del costo es la vulnerabilidad en su seguridad, al igual que MySQL es uno de los más usados a nivel mundial.

SQLite

 

Es un sistema gestor de base de datos compatible con ACID (Atomicidad, Consistencia, Aislamiento y Durabilidad), ACID son las características que clasifican las transiciones en los SGBD, cuenta con una pequeña biblioteca creada en C, a diferencia de los demás que se funcionan como un proceso aparte este se integra al mismo sistema.

SQL Server

Este SGBD está enfocado para entornos empresariales, originalmente el código de MySQL server fue desarrollado por Sybase y durante un tiempo Microsoft y Sybase siguieron generando productos de MySQL server, tiempo después Sybase cambio el nombre de su producto llamándolo Adaptive Server Enterprise.

SQL server cuenta con un entrono grafico para administración, en este se pueden usar comandos DDL y DML de manera gráfica, es escalable, estable y permite administrar información de otros servidores.

Microsoft Access

Este gestor de base de datos viene incluido dentro de la paquetería de Microsoft office, es de fácil uso permite crear bases de datos rápidamente, cuenta con plantillas para crear aplicaciones sencillas pero funcionales, su lanzamiento fue en el año de 1992.

PostgreSQL

Es un gestor de base de datos bajo la licencia, sustituye el uso de multihilos por multiprocesos garantizando de esta manera la estabilidad del sistema, es bastante popular y fácil de administrar, la sintaxis de SQL que usa es bastante rápida y fácil de aprender, es multiplataforma, en comparación con otros gestores es lento en actualizaciones y su consumo de recursos es más alto que el de MySQL.

El objetivo principal de estos gestores es hacer más amable la interacción con la base de datos, existen un sinfín de ellos, cada uno con características distintas algunas de ellos completamente.

Descargar este artículo en PDF

Lo sentimos, esta opción solo está disponible para los socios. Más información de nuestro grupo de socios.


Xochitl Rodriguez
Técnico en informática y estudiante de Ingeniería Informatica

Déjanos un comentario:

  • Gustavo Patles

    Oracle vulnerable!!
    Tiene una suite de seguridad altamente configurable y robusta.
    Y si a esto se le suma una seguridad perimetral decente no hay problemas.
    Database firewall, Database Vault, Transparent Data Encryption, Data Redaction, Data Masking, son los productos adicionalmente a lo relativo a single sign on y las funcionalidades de auditoria y control de la base de datos out of the box, sin contar Audit Vault como repositorio de todos los controles que realizan estos productos
    Es posible encriptar el tráfico de los listeners entre la base de datos y los clientes, es posible encriptar la base completa, se puede hacer enmascaramiento de datos por nivel de acceso. Si usted tiene una base de datos Oracle es porque tiene una base crítica, si la base es crítica y no pone los controles de seguridad pertinentes, el problema es del diseño de la solución no de Oracle.
    Espero que saquen esa aseveración de que Oracle es vulnerable de la nota.
    Saludos…

  • Eduard Avendaño

    Se puede escribir algo mejor, toca investigar más para que quede algo más profesional.